Metal Roof vs. Shingle Roof: An Overview

Before diving into the advantages and disadvantages, let's rapidly outline what each roofing type requires. Metal roof usually involves products like steel, aluminum, or copper, while shingle roof primarily utilizes asphalt or wood shingles.

What is Metal Roofing?

Metal roof has actually acquired popularity for its resilience and longevity. It can last anywhere from 40 to 70 years with very little maintenance. Additionally, advancements in technology have actually made metal roofing systems more aesthetically pleasing, using styles that imitate standard shingles or tiles.

What are Shingle Roofs?

Shingle roofing systems are possibly the most typical roof product used in houses today. They are typically less expensive in advance than metal roofs however may need more regular repairs and replacements over time.

Durability: Metal vs. Shingles

How Long Do Each Last?

    Metal Roofing: Lasts between 40 to 70 years. Shingle Roofing: Usually lasts around 20 to 30 years.

If you're trying to find durability in your roof replacement options, metal may be your finest bet.

Cost Factors to consider: Initial Financial Investment vs Long-Term Value

Initial Expenses of Metal Roof vs Shingles

While metal roofs include a higher preliminary price-- ranging from $120 to $900 per square-- shingles generally cost in between $90 to $100 per square for asphalt shingles.

Long-Term Worth Analysis

Though shingle roofs are more affordable initially, they may lead to higher expenses due to regular roofing repairs or replacements needed every couple of years. On the other hand, metal roof's long life-span can result in lower lifetime costs overall.

Aesthetic Appeal: Which Looks Better?

Design Versatility of Metal Roofing

Metal roofings are available in different colors and designs that can mimic traditional materials like tile or slate.

The Traditional Appeal of Shingles

Shingles supply a relaxing aesthetic that numerous house owners enjoy. They can be easily matched with different architectural designs but might lack the contemporary flair that some property owners desire.

Energy Effectiveness: Keeping Your Home Cool or Warm?

Does Metal Deal Much better Insulation?

Metal roofing reflects solar convected heat which can decrease energy expenses by keeping your home cooler during summertime months.

Shingles and Their Thermal Properties

While asphalt shingles do not reflect heat as effectively as metal roofing systems, they still provide good insulation when correctly set up with an underlayment.

Environmental Effect: Which is Greener?

Sustainability of Metal Roofs

Most metal roofs are made from recycled materials and can be totally recycled at end-of-life. This makes them an environmentally friendly choice for environmentally mindful homeowners.

Shingle Waste Concerns

On the other hand, asphalt shingles contribute significantly to landfill waste considering that they can not be recycled easily compared to their metal counterparts.

Maintenance Requirements: Just how much Work Will You Need to Do?

Is Metal Roof Low Maintenance?

Yes! Among the most significant benefits of metal roofing systems is their low maintenance requirements. They resist mold growth and do not break or warp easily.

Maintenance Requirements for Shingle Roofs

Regular examinations and periodic roofing system repairs will likely be necessary with shingle roofs due to wear from weather like wind and rain.

Weather Resistance: Battling Nature's Elements

Can Metal Manage Extreme Weather?

Definitely! Metal roofing systems excel in severe climate condition such as heavy snowfall or high winds thanks to their lightweight yet durable composition.

Are Shingles Hard Enough Against Serious Weather?

While shingles perform well under typical conditions, severe storms can raise them off your roofing if not installed correctly.

Noise Levels Throughout Rainfall: Is it Loud Underfoot?

Sound Quality of Metal Roofs

Some people stress over noise when it rains on a metal roofing; nevertheless, proper insulation considerably minimizes any sound issues.

Shingles vs Sound Levels

Shingles tend to dampen sound more effectively than metal when rain puts down heavily.

Fire Resistance Rankings: Security First!

Fire Ranking of Metal Roofs

Metal roofings have a Class A fire rating which implies they provide exceptional protection against fire hazards.

Fire Security with Asphalt Shingles

Most asphalt shingles also bring a Class A ranking but can deteriorate in time under extreme heat.

Installation Problem Level: What's Involved?

Installing Metal Roofing systems: A Job for Professionals

Due to their weight and specific installation methods needed (like thermal growth), working with professional roofer is frequently advised.

Is Shingle Setup Easy?

Installing shingles tends to be more uncomplicated; nevertheless, DIY enthusiasts should still proceed carefully!

Insurance Factors to consider: Impact on Premiums

What Does Insurance Say About These Options?

Many insurance provider offer discounts for homes with metal roofing systems since they're less prone to damage than shingles.

How Do Shingle Roofs Affect Insurance Costs?

Conversely, homes with shingle roofs may see higher premiums due to increased probability of requiring roof repair work post-storm.

Resale Worth Implications

Does Metal Increase Resale Value?

Absolutely! Residences equipped with resilient products like metal frequently offer quicker and at higher costs than those including just standard shingled roofs.
